The debate heats up mainly because it's a clash of styles: Beckenbauer's defensive mastery and leadership versus Platini's offensive brilliance and flair. Both players transformed their positions and left a lasting legacy, making it a riveting comparison for fans.
Fans cherish Michel Platini for his incredible skill as a playmaker and his knack for scoring decisive goals, especially during his time in Juventus and the French national team. His artistic style of play resonates with those who love soccer played with flair and creativity.
Franz Beckenbauer is leading significantly, largely because of his revolutionary role as a sweeper in soccer, which changed how defenders were viewed. Fans appreciate his tactical intelligence and leadership on the field, contributing to his iconic status and strong lead in the votes.
